"Together until we perish: Two lanterns together" is a picture of two lantern plant lanterns that are already almost digested. The skeleton of the veins can be seen beautifully as a result. The reflection of the lanterns can be seen on the grey-silver beige background. The soft light natural colours of the left lantern, among others, give this part a peaceful look. The right-hand lantern still has a large part of its "skin". This means it is still largely orange, which gives it a warm, expressive look (and is also reflected in the berry of the left-hand lantern).
By lighting the lanterns like this, it looks as if a light is shining in the right-hand lantern. The orange inside looks a bit like light.
The colours remind me of some old-fashioned (vintage) colours and autumn: brown (beige, taupe) and orange are the most common colours in the picture.
If you zoom in on the work and look at the lanterns, you can see the texture beautifully highlighted in the light.
